A resolution asking grocery chain Kroger Co. to come up with a plan to reduce its plastic packaging nearly passed at the company s annual meeting June 24, with 45 percent of shareholders voting in favor.
Green investment group As You Sow said in a June 29 statement that it urged Kroger, the largest U.S. grocery chain by revenue, to prepare a report by December estimating how much of its plastic packaging is released to the environment from production, disposal and recycling.
The AYS resolution also asked shareholders to require Kroger management to disclose detailed strategies to reduce plastic in packaging.
Similar resolutions at other major companies in recent months resulted in those firms agreeing to sizable cutbacks in the amount of virgin plastic they use.
